Court throws out Senate Pres. Lawan, orders INEC to publish Machina as Yobe North senatorial candidate

The hope of Senate President Ahmad Lawan returning to the Upper legislative chamber was again dashed as a Federal High Court in Damaturu, Yobe State Capital, nullified the candidature of Lawan for the 2023 senatorial poll.

The court on Wednesday declared Bashir Sheriff Machina as the All Progressives Congress’ authentic senatorial candidate for Yobe North Senatorial District.

Justice Fadima Murtala Aminu, who gave the order, directed the APC to forward the name of Machina to INEC as the authentic winner of the primary held on May 28, 2022.

He described the primary election which produced Lawan as the senatorial candidate as “phantom”.

Persecondnews recalls that Lawan had contested the party’s presidential primary with Asiwaju Bola Tinubu, Vice- President Yemi Osinbajo (SAN), Rotimi Amaechi and others while the senatorial primary was being conducted simultaneously.

Tinubu won the primary while the party had prevailed on Machina, who won the ticket to step down for Lawan.
